DESECRATION AND OUTRAGE

FATE OF AN ITALIAN OFFICER. Australian-New Zealand Cable Association. Rome, July 19. Dr. Battisti, the Deputy for Tront in the Austrian Parliament, was seriously vvountlecl when fighting as {in Italian officer. Bfo committed suicide rather than facc a trial at Austrian hands. The Anstrians held a, mock treason trial over the'body and. hanged it. There is furious indignation, and demands for reprisals aro general throughout Italy. . [Dr. Battisti, a former Reichsrath representative • for Trentino, who enlisted in the Italian Army, was reported .to fcave been captured and executed.]
